Jim WaggenerAll of my work is created using copper and brass sheet, patina, and other elements such as gold and silver leaf, sterling silver sheet.

I hand work the metal using hammers, burnishers, punches, scribes, textured steel plates, and wood blocks. Many tools I hand make.

After raising, sinking, and stretching the metal into the shape I am looking for it is then cleaned and numerous patinas are applied, drying between layers, until the finished effect is achieved.Forming

The often craggy textures and vivid colors created by the forces of nature inspire my work. By hand forming metal and integrating patinas along with other media, I interpret the visual and emotional beauty created by this timeless action, and the stunning transformations that occur.

chasingMany of my works are named after geological terms used to describe natural formations. Upheaval, texture, erosion and renewal are elements that inspire my work.forming
